Removing an axle nut without wheels on
 
I'm installing my RC 2.5" lift on my 97 4wd Jimmy and need to remove my axle nut but don't have the wheels on it. I was wondering how to lock up the front axle enough to remove the nut. I have tried braking while trying to remove the nut, but I just spin the rotor. I was hoping you guys could help me out. I know this is a stupid question, but thanks in advanced.

AJBert 05-26-2013 02:00 PM

Crow bar and a rag. Position the crow bar with the rag wrapped around it in the appropriate areas between a couple of the studs on the rotor. A helper comes in very handy to hold the crow bar while you crank on the axle nut. You could also use some vacuum tubing/PVC piping of such size to fit just a little loose on the studs.

If you mess up a stud, they are cheap and easy to replace.
